Як імпортувати, читати, змінювати дані з EXCEL у QTP/UFT
Кроки для імпорту, читання та зміни даних із EXCEL
У цьому підручнику ми будемо працювати з Excel із Micro Focus UFT
Припустімо, що ми хочемо імпортувати такий Sales.xls
Після імпорту в HP UFT верхній рядок стає заголовком стовпця. Тому відповідно структуруйте свої дані.
Синтаксис імпорту всього файлу Excel такий
DataTable.Import(FileName)
У нашому випадку
Datatable.import "D:\Automation\Sales.xls"
Синтаксис імпорту певного аркуша такий
DataTable.ImportSheet(FileName, SheetSource, SheetDest)
Використовуйте метод Getrowcount, щоб отримати кількість рядків на аркуші
Datatable.import "D:\Automation\Sales.xls"row = Datatable.getsheet(1).Getrowcount MsgBox row
Для встановлення поточного рядка використовується метод SetCurrentRow
Datatable.import "D:\Automation\Sales.xls"DataTable.SetCurrentRow(1)
' У наведеному нижче коді 1 є номером аркуша
Row1= Datatable.Value("Year",1) DataTable.SetCurrentRow(2) Row2= Datatable.Value("Year",1) MsgBox("Year Row 1 =" & Row1 & " Year Row 2 =" & Row2 )
Використовувати значення метод зміни даних в імпортованому аркуші. Використовувати Експорт метод експорту Excel